This command changes to reflect what you have selected: cases, attributes, or text. Using it removes the selection and puts it on the clipboard (which means you can then paste it somewhere else: into another collection or text object in the current document, in another document, or in another application).

 

Cut differs from Copy in that it removes the selection rather than simply putting the selection on the clipboard.

 

The keyboard shortcut also works when you are editing a formula (although the menu command is not available when the formula editor is open).

Shortcut: Win: Ctrl+X; Mac: z+X
